NUMS hoopsters tally wins against London

By Bob Putman 

By Bob Putman, Richwood Gazette

North Union Middle School’s eighth-grade basketball teams each posted victories against London.

The girls team won 44-28 as Tinlee Martino scored 24 points and Chloe McElroy added 11 points.

Hayes Miller scored 12 points in leading the boys team to a 53-15 win.

The seventh-grade teams were not as fortunate as they each lost.

The girls team lost 34-21 and the boys lost 59-21.

Nuna Baker had 11 points for the Lady Cats and Luke Mask netted 13 points for the boys squad.
